How they compare
Montenegro currently reports 30.0% against 24.2% in Albania, a difference of 5.8%.
That makes Montenegro's figure about 1.2 times Albania's.
Across all 7 years both countries report, Montenegro has been ahead every year.
Albania ranks 3rd and Montenegro ranks 2nd of 47 countries.
Montenegro has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.
